2009 smart ForTwo review
There is a website called evilution It goes over many smart car maintenance and known concerns even for my 2009 smart car for two passion. Get oil changed, tires are low cost to change. Gas is great 40 mpg. One Achilles of the car is the clutch actuator, but it isn’t broke it just needs to be cleaned and lubed with new gear grease not spray which only is a temporary fix.park car on ramps in park, make sure extension arm on actuator isn’t engaged (park position) , spray paint three bolts to try to put back in same position which in park should be snug against clutch plate in clutch housing , disconnect negative battery terminal, gently unsnap sensor and unscrew three bolts and remove actuator, remove and cleans rubber boot with soap water, cover sensor port so don’t get wet with towel, take apart actuator using hex screwdriver or star screwdriver, brake cleaner let dry, the. spray some white lithium oil in actuator generously , then apply generous gear lube in the drywall gun tube everywhere , hex actuator back together, lube tip clutch plate contact arm that makes contact with clutch plate in clutch housing, put rubber boot back on, screw back in same position snug against clutch plate for resistance to start, screw three bolts , connect sensor, connect negative terminal battery, start up will get wrench symbol till resets, move forward and back and check see it gears are shifting by moving a little, may not start make sure push arm to have snug tension of actuator extension arm on clutch plate in housing , without this tension may not start. Resistance or tension is required to start so tip must contact clutch plate. Note: if arm is extended when removed the spring will shoot it out and to start it you need to get tip shrunk from extended position which would can only do by starting car but you can’t start it because actuator does not fit back in position if extended and resistance extension is not recognized. so one person must attempting to start car while 2nd person connects sensor and doesn’t bolt three bolts in but holds actuator in hand and 2nd person under car pushes actuator against tip to simulate EXACT resistance tensiOn on extended arm to start, you are guessing on force, I used brick to push squeeze arm in corner squeezing tip into solid metal by pushing tip in corner then at same time have other person try to start car, guessing how much force it takes, , you have to replicate the exact tension of plate in housing to get car to start and extension arm to shrink to park position, once car starts th not will go to shrunk position and fit in park position in default position , used park brake , hold brakes on start for safety of second person, took like 40 tries and a dead battery from failed starts but will start then let run until it shrinks arm, once arm is shrunk then install in snug position or position spray painted before removed. Also, Spark plugs I unscrew and use snug rubber house to pull out from tight fit, oil changed at shop, check tires once a month, check fluids , battery is under passengers foot carpet, engine is in back hatch just lift carpet, some fluids in front engine, rear tail lights easy to replace just pinch lose. Two complains: seat do not extend back to lay back and take a nap after a long day, car is loud on highway noise but keeps up, other notes car makes a whine noise on start up for 30 seconds or 90 seconds seems normal. Gas mileage great, which could put bigger tires on for a farm or rough country roads but can cut plastic away from tire well I guess. Low tire center on f gravity is okay but need farm option. Mercedes dealership is a stealership but smart car forums, rock auto parts, and website evilution is great to do it yourself . Plastic exterior is forgiving on dents, use 3m to remove glue, use stickers to cover any blemishes.paint holds well since plastic.

2009 smart ForTwo review
This is my 2nd one, 1st was used for a 150 mile + a day 5 day week commute to the DC area. It's in it's element for local driving, parking, mpg, fun to drive(especially with convertible). If you install a Scan Gauge and use the manual paddle shifters, mid 50 mpg is easy. Interstate driving keeps the mpg to around 42 +. 1st one had some issues, but incompetent mechanics were most of the problems. Replacement a/c hoses run $1200 each (2)does require Premium fuel, I alternated between mid & prem. each tank on the 1st. one. Get an extended warranty, any major repairs may have to be done by MB dealer.

2009 smart ForTwo review
I use this car for business purposes. I drive about 1500 miles per month. I live in Colorado so it?s cold in the winter. I get approximately 42 miles to the gallon in the winter and about 38 in the summer because of the air conditioning. This is definitely not a luxury vehicle but it?s really not bad especially for the price. It has a great turning radius. There is a lot more room inside then you would expect. It has a very tight suspension so you are very aware of every bump that you hit. It also has a 70 hp engine so if you expect to get from 0 to 60 in anything less than five minutes this probably isn?t the car for you. However, I have never had any issues with the car and is very reliable. I have put approximately 40,000 miles on it since I got it and it currently has 60,000. My biggest complaint with the car is that rattles regularly, like something is loose but I cannot figure out what it is. It is worth mentioning that this used to be a ?Car to Go? and who knows what they did to it to fit it for their credit card charging systems, so this may be their fault. You can hear road noise quite a bit in this car. I love the fact that it is little and you can park it anywhere. You could make a U-turn basically anywhere. It does not go well in the snow so if you live in a snowy climate you might consider something else unless you have a winter vehicle.

About smart
Which smart vehicle has the best MPG?
The smart ForTwo with traditional internal combustion engine offers up to 34 MPG city and 39 MPG highway for a combined rating of 36 MPG.
These figures are based on EPA mileage ratings and are for comparison purposes only. The actual mileage will vary depending on the selected vehicle model year, trim, driving conditions, driving habits, vehicle maintenance, and other factors.
Which smart vehicle has the longest range?
The electric smart ForTwo Electric Drive can travel up to 68 miles on a single charge depending on electric motor and battery options.
EPA-estimated range is the distance, or predicted distance, a new plug-in vehicle will travel on electric power before its battery charge is exhausted. Actual range will vary depending on model year, driving conditions, driving habits, elevation changes, weather, accessory usage (lights, climate control), vehicle condition and other factors.
